#9e72bd h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#9e72bd is composed of 62% red, 44.7%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.4%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 275.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.2% and a lightness of 59.4%. #9e72b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#3d007b.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050306 is the darkest color, while #faf8fc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98929d is the less saturated color, while #a932fd is the most saturated one.
